Mental Health Awareness Life can be overwhelming. Anxiety, depression, burnout, and fear aren’t just modern problems—they’ve been part of the human story for a long time. Even great heroes of faith, like Elijah, had moments where they wanted to give up entirely.
In this honest and hope-filled series, we’ll walk through Elijah’s breakdown under the broom tree, explore what it means to renew our minds and be transformed from the inside out, and sit with Jesus in the garden as He wrestles with sorrow and anguish.If you're struggling, you're not alone—and you're not broken beyond repair. This series is for you.
If you love someone who is hurting and don't know how to help, this series is for you, too.
God doesn’t shame us for our weakness. He meets us in it—and offers something better than quick fixes or empty platitudes: His presence, His power, and His peace.
